The League was only around for 2 seasons, 1949-50 & 1950-51. It was a Winter League for some major league ballplayers and some Negro League players.
1947 Brooklyn Dodger and first Black pitcher in the Majors Dan Bankhead played in this Winter League. Tommy Lasorda also played there.
This is a Game Used Ball from the Championship Game of 1949-1950 season.
On the ball itself reads:
"Cristobal Mottas Canal Zone League Champions 1949-50"
Another panel reads:
"This ball caught by Bascelici (sp.) for last out in the final game for championship against Balboa"
Then looks to be signed by someone I can't make out and on another panel lists "Mgr Al Kuboski", another panel writing I can't make out.
